Short Interest in Clean Energy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:CETY) Drops By 37.4%

Clean Energy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:CETYGet Free Report) was the target of a large decline in short interest during the month of July. As of July 15th, there was short interest totaling 33,169 shares, a decline of 37.4% from the June 30th total of 53,015 shares. Approximately 0.4% of the shares of the stock are short sold. Based on an average daily volume of 36,613 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.9 days.

Clean Energy Technologies, Inc (NASDAQ: CETY) is an energy technology company focused on the design, development and operation of renewable natural gas (RNG) systems. By deploying anaerobic digestion solutions, the company captures methane emissions from agricultural and organic waste streams and upgrades it into pipeline-quality RNG. This process not only reduces greenhouse gas emissions but also provides a sustainable energy alternative that can be used in utility gas grids, heavy-duty transportation and industrial applications.

The company offers a turnkey service model that spans project feasibility, engineering, equipment supply, construction management, financing and ongoing operations and maintenance.
